I get a crash (double free) with:

    echo '\endinput \end ' | context --pipe

and I get a 'normal' Fatal error occurred with:

   echo '\\endinput \\end' | context --pipe

and I think that solves that bit of the mystery.

Now for that double-free:

   echo '\tracingall \endinput \end ' | context --pipe

ends with:

> {\endinput}
>
> \end ->\ctxcommand {forceendjob()}
>
> \ctxcommand #1->\directlua \zerocount {commands.#1}
> #1<-forceendjob()
> {\directlua}
> system          > don't use \end to finish a document
> *** glibc detected *** luatex: double free or corruption (fasttop): 0x0000000004c21340 ***


It probably crashes because in context the \end code and the \endinput
code interfere with eachother. You get the same crash if you create a
simple input file with just that same line, and the crash goes away if
you put \endinput and \end on separate lines, and as far as I can tell,
context always crashes if \endinput and \end/\stoptext are on the same
line.
